This is a port of Cyanogenmod 13 for the Samsung Galaxy Tab A 7.0 (2016) LTE SM-T285. Cyanogenmod needs no introduction, it is one of the most popular aftermarket ROM distributions around.
5.1.1 is the best that you can get from samsung right now and it is not known if they plan to do any upgrades. I have absolutely no idea why samsung chose to stay with the outdated 5.1.1 mid 2016 when we already got 7.1 coming out. This custom rom is probably the best you can get if you want an upgrade from Lollipop. Performance on the latest build is also better, you be the judge.
This ROM is stable enough to be my current daily driver, however please take note of the issues noted below. Feature are on par or exceeds my OMNIRom builds in terms of features and performance. However do note that CyanogenMod has a lot more features and brings about its own bugs as well.
Based off on Cyanogenmod 13 sources which is based on Marshmallow 6.0.1

Xtreme Edition Builds
=================
Xtreme Edition builds are aggressively optimized and possibly unstable builds (though I do test them for some time to ensure minimum stability). Warning this build is only for enthusiasts that want to tinker settings to achieve the best performance possible for this device (using Kernel Auditor is recommended). Speed should be noticeable especially when coming from stock or non optimized builds.
Feature List:
* Kernel and system files compiled with the latest linaro toolchain 6.2.1 with -O3 optimization
* Additional hotplug and CPU governors installed (tweak with your hearts content with Kernel Auditor)
* Max clockspeed slightly bumped to 1.54Ghz from 1.5Ghz
* Various speed optimization patches to the kernel
* Support for KSM (Kernel same page merging)
* Support for both Ext4 and F2FS for the data and cache partitions (Use TWRP to switch to your desired FS)
* SELinux enabled
* ExFAT and NTFS support built-in
* Improved doze and low power mode support
* Antutu Score 26325 (KSM disabled, IntelliPlug Enabled, F2FS data and cache partitions)
* USB Audio/MIDI support (untested)
* Added new I/O schedulers (row, bfq etc.)
* Other optimizations and fixes I can't remember

system.img is a sparse ext4 image. You need to use simg2img and mount it as an ext4 filesystem. What device do you want to port it too? This works only for the SM-T285 right now.

NOTE ON BUTTONS: This ROM is configured to use the hardware buttons-- so you won't see the software buttons taking up space at the bottom of the screen, as they are disabled. This is not a bug. Use the hardware buttons, as they are the same. If you really want the software buttons for some reason, edit /system/build.prop, change qemu.hw.mainkeys to 0, save, and reboot. If you map the menu button to a long press of another button, some apps such as TitaniumBackup will count this as a hardware key and hide their soft menu button - but only after a reboot.
NOTE ON CIFS/NFS: Many of the mounting utilities on the play store are outdated and broken due to changes in the linux kernel. For best luck, mount using the command line. For CIFS, you can tweak CIFSManager into working - see this thread

Workaround for apk install issue
=========================
Due to a possible bug with how sdcardfs is implemented in this device, apks downloaded externally and placed in external storage like Download show the apk is corrupt error when trying to install it.
however you can do a workaround by having root and doing the following:
1. Root your device (Download SuperSU and install via TWRP)
2. Download root file explorer
3. Using root file explorer move your apk to /data/local/tmp or create a folder under /data/local and move it there
4. Install the apk from that location and it should work.
Note that apps downloaded from the play store or install using "adb install" are not affected and works properly.

The Unlegacy Android Project​Introduction
Unlegacy-Android started out as the OMAP4-AOSP Project. It was created in late 2015 in order to maintain a clean and organized place for pure AOSP support for various OMAP4 devices, such as the Galaxy Nexus and the Samsung Galaxy Tab 2 series. Over time this evolved to support more than just these devices, but still maintains its roots of supporting "legacy" devices that no longer receive "official" updates: hence Unlegacy Android was born. In our opinion, these ROMs are how the official updates would look.
On top of AOSP, we only include changes which are necessary to support the hardware, be secure, and get acceptable performance. Current features for flo/deb include:
- Linux kernel 3.4.y merged in (currently 3.4.108 - mostly security patches and minor bug fixes)
- BFQ IO scheduler (official kernel 3.4 release), set up so GUI processes have the highest priority
- F2FS support from kernel 4.9 (for /data only!)
- SELinux in Enforcing mode

If you want to install GApps, we recommend Open GApps Micro.
An important note: as this is a pure AOSP ROM, installing GApps tends to be problematic: in order to try to avoid installation issues, be sure to install GApps immediately after installing the ROM, before booting the system for the first time. If you experience any issues with the Google applications, be sure to go into Settings -> Apps, and grant every permission to every Google application - most importantly, Google Play services.
In the case of an upgrade, be sure to re-install the GApps package, as upgrading wipes /system. You shouldn't need to re-set the permissions afterwards.

Not sure if answered but I fixed this by:
Copying the complete line ro.vendor.build.fingerprint.................. from the /system/build.prop file.
Paste replacing the line ro.vendor.build.fingerprint.................. in the /vendor/build.prop file.
These files crosscheck each other looking for this line. The files must be from different builds.
